Output b03756cb149c1701810fe08a62a6330785d2066aae21cba569e31e54a485a7d5:109

value
315571
script pubkey
OP_0 OP_PUSHBYTES_20 5d18d6b10ea580fb4a45157b895b7f74f243bbb2
address
bc1qt5vddvgw5kq0kjj9z4acjkmlwney8waj49andj
transaction
b03756cb149c1701810fe08a62a6330785d2066aae21cba569e31e54a485a7d5
confirmations
135989
spent
true